Compress with Ghostscript

ghostscript command can be used to compress PDF files. It has multiple predefined settings:

-dPDFSETTINGS=configuration

Presets the "distiller parameters" to one of four predefined settings:

/screen selects low-resolution output similar to the Acrobat Distiller (up to version X) "Screen Optimized" setting.

/ebook selects medium-resolution output similar to the Acrobat Distiller (up to version X) "eBook" setting.

/printer selects output similar to the Acrobat Distiller "Print Optimized" (up to version X) setting.

/prepress selects output similar to Acrobat Distiller "Prepress Optimized" (up to version X) setting.

/default selects output intended to be useful across a wide variety of uses, possibly at the expense of a larger output file.
